How To Recognize Signs Of Toyota EV Brake System Issues
The brake system is a crucial safety component in any vehicle, and Toyota EVs are no exception. While EVs utilize regenerative braking that reduces mechanical wear, traditional brakes remain essential for stopping power and overall safety. Recognizing early signs of brake system issues allows owners to take proactive measures, whether driving a pre-owned car or a new model, ensuring reliable and safe operation.
Understanding Toyota EV Braking Systems
Toyota EVs feature a combination of regenerative and conventional hydraulic braking systems. Regenerative braking captures energy during deceleration to recharge the battery, reducing wear on brake pads and rotors. However, hydraulic brakes are still necessary for complete stopping power, emergency braking, and low-speed maneuvers.
Due to this dual system, brake issues in EVs can present differently than in traditional vehicles. Problems may originate from mechanical components, regenerative system sensors, or electronic control units. Understanding the interplay between these systems is key to recognizing potential faults early.
Common Symptoms of Brake Issues
Several indicators suggest that a Toyota EV may have a braking problem. One of the most noticeable signs is unusual noises, such as squealing or grinding, which often point to worn brake pads or rotors. Drivers may also experience a spongy or soft brake pedal, indicating potential air in the hydraulic lines or low brake fluid levels.
Another symptom can be reduced regenerative braking efficiency. If the EV no longer slows as expected during energy recovery, the system may require inspection. Warning lights on the dashboard, including the brake system indicator or ABS warning light, also provide immediate alerts to potential issues that should not be ignored.
Performance Changes and Handling Concerns
Brake problems may affect overall vehicle performance and handling. Increased stopping distances, uneven braking, or pulling to one side during braking are signs that either the hydraulic or regenerative braking system is malfunctioning. In some cases, software issues may affect regenerative braking responsiveness, which can be diagnosed and recalibrated by a trained technician.
Regular driving assessments help detect these changes early. Noticing differences in braking behavior during routine trips allows the driver to schedule inspections before minor issues develop into costly repairs. Preventive Maintenance and Professional Inspections
Maintaining a Toyota EV’s brake system requires adherence to a recommended service schedule. Routine inspections include checking brake pads, rotors, hydraulic fluid, and regenerative braking sensors. Even though regenerative braking reduces pad wear, periodic evaluation prevents unexpected issues and ensures consistent performance.
For pre-owned vehicles, a comprehensive brake inspection is essential before purchase. Certified technicians can assess the condition of all braking components, confirm proper system calibration, and recommend preventive repairs. For new vehicles, maintaining regular inspections and updates keeps both mechanical and electronic brake components functioning optimally, ensuring the driver’s safety on every journey.
